About

Benjamin Watson is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Human-Computer Interaction and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design. According to data from OpenAlex, Benjamin Watson has authored 51 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, 13 papers in Human-Computer Interaction and 11 papers in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design. Recurrent topics in Benjamin Watson’s work include Computer Graphics and Visualization Techniques (11 papers), Data Visualization and Analytics (10 papers) and Virtual Reality Applications and Impacts (10 papers). Benjamin Watson is often cited by papers focused on Computer Graphics and Visualization Techniques (11 papers), Data Visualization and Analytics (10 papers) and Virtual Reality Applications and Impacts (10 papers). Benjamin Watson coll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and United Kingdom. Benjamin Watson's co-authors include Martin Reddy, David Luebke, Jonathan D. Cohen, Amitabh Varshney, Robert J. Huebner, Larry F. Hodges, G. Drew Kessler, Dan Opdyke, Barbara O. Rothbaum and Neff Walker and has published in prestigious journals such as Behaviour Research and Therapy, ACM Transactions on Graphics and Computer.
